Acts 20:24-26
Revised Standard Version
24 But I do not account my life of any value nor as precious to myself, if only I may accomplish my course and the ministry which I received from the Lord Jesus, to testify to the gospel of the grace of God. 25 And now, behold, I know that all you among whom I have gone preaching the kingdom will see my face no more. 26 Therefore I testify to you this day that I am innocent of the blood of all of you,

Acts 20:24-26
New International Version
24 However, I consider my life worth nothing to me;(A) my only aim is to finish the race(B) and complete the task(C) the Lord Jesus has given me(D)—the task of testifying to the good news of God’s grace.(E)
25 “Now I know that none of you among whom I have gone about preaching the kingdom(F) will ever see me again.(G) 26 Therefore, I declare to you today that I am innocent of the blood of any of you.(H)
